About South Baltimore Learning Center
South Baltimore Learning Center is an Education Management company providing adults with the most appropriate literacy course offerings, designed to suit abilities, improve performance, and ensures success. What Is the Cost of Living Near Baltimore?

Understanding the cost of living near Baltimore is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at South Baltimore Learning Center.
Baltimore's Cost of Living Index is approximately 91.8 (8.2% less expensive than US average; 18.8% less than MD average). Major city, historic, affordable housing in many areas, but varies greatly by neighborhood. MTA bus/Light Rail/Metro Subway.
